Software Engineer: Core Team (LA)
LOCATION: the Rubicon Project HQ in West Los Angeles
Responsibilities:
- Write production-ready code and unit tests that meet the business owners' need
- Complete items on the team work queue, including but not limited to new feature requests, bug fixes, performance investigation, and log mining
- Participate in daily standups, weekly retrospective and planning meetings
Qualifications:
- Bachelor's degree
- Significant experience working with large-scale web applications with high-traffic demands
- Interested (preferably with experience) in large-scale computation technologies (e.x. MapReduce, genetic algorithms, etc.)
- Good communicator and comfortable working on cross-functional teams
- Desire to practice (or even better, experience with!) pair-programming and test-driven development (TDD)
- Strong on code quality and maintainability, but able to balance that with the pragmatism necessary to release product in a timely fashion
- Former managers describe you as an extremely productive contributor with a get-it-done attitude
Skills/Personal Characteristics:
- Looking to code in a field and on an application which is extremely relevant
- Desire to work in an environment where software engineers are not just cubicle coders but full participants in shaping the product and the business
- Interested in being involved in all phases of the product lifecycle from requirements to release and maintenance
- Excited about interact with a group of creative, like-minded engineers who are passionate about software, software systems, and technology in general
Product & Engineering
- Interfaces Engineer
- Software Engineer, Brand Security & Protection (SEA)
- Sr. QA Engineer (LA)
- Product Manager/Director (LA)
- Software Engineer: Core Team (LA)
- Database Administrator (LA)
